Posted by WendyK (Member # 18918) on :
 
I had the picc for 6 months for rocephin. I was exhausted, ached all over,constant headaches, brain fog galore, no motivation when I started it. 4-5 weeks in I started getting daily fevers, which were new for me and the joints got waaayyy worse.

Then suddenly after a really bad night, the joint pain improved significantly and things got better over several months.

Then things were just holding steady for a while. I've actually not had any rocephin for a few weeks now, to see if I would relapse, but things have stayed pretty steady, so he gave the go ahead to pull the line yesterday.
